Pros

1. Very strong product and a credible problem space You are selling into real enterprise pain. The underlying tech has depth. This holds up in serious conversations with CIOs, Ops leaders, and transformation teams. 2. Access to large, complex accounts You get exposure to global enterprises and GCCs. Deals are strategic, not transactional. Good environment to build enterprise selling capability. 3. High ownership and visibility Small teams. You own accounts end to end. Direct access to leadership when needed.

Cons

1. Category is still forming You spend time explaining the problem before selling the solution. Sales cycles are long. Pipeline build takes effort. 2. Need for flexible positioning at times Messaging can change as the company refines its narrative. This creates friction in sales conversations and enablement. 3. Limited repeatable playbooks You build your own approach in many cases. Less support in terms of proven templates, assets, and deal structures. It's a whole new world.

Pros

Growth - the company has found an area with deep tech where there is a big opportunity to change work experiences for working teams. Everyone is very focused on the business goals to move the company forward. Leadership shares info on how the products / our work is making an impact to customers, and what needs to improve as well. Product and engineering continually trying to improve those areas to benefit the customer experience. 2. Smart people - Soroco definitely has some of the best talent, I work with really smart people and diverse teams, it makes the environment collaborative where learning is a constant.

Cons

Collaborating across time zones can be challenging and leads to long days, but that is expected in a global company that is growing at this fast pace. This is pretty much expected everywhere in organizations globally. The work guidelines allow for comp. offs and flexibility to adjust to varied hours - needs prior discussion and planning with managers though.
